The unknown is colorless, odorless, and neutral. When mixed with NaOH it produced a brown precipitate and when mixed with BaCl2 it produced a white precipitate. Reactions with other halides gave yellow precipitates. What unknown is it? Write the exchange reaction with the unknown and NaOH. Write the balanced reaction between the unknown and BaCl2. Specify the states in all reactions.
